Wiz Khalifa dedicates Billboard Music Awards` performance to late Paul Walker

Washington : American rapper Wiz Khalifa paid tribute to late ‘Fast and Furious’ star Paul Walker at the recently held 2015 Billboard Music Awards.

The 27-year-old rapper gave a profound performance on his hit single ‘See You Again’ at the award night, E! Online reported.

The American singer Charlie Puth who sung the track, gave everyone a teary eye when he opened the emotional song on the piano.

The music video features footage of Walker from the franchise’s most recent film, as well as the six others from the past 14 years, honoring his heritage in the mega-popular film series and showcasing his relationship with his cast-mates.
